Hi there

After the latest update some features like (address/tab bar customisation) are missing or frozen, I cannot now move the address bar to the bottom, which is very annoying and inconvenient. Could you please help me fixing this issue?

A Screenshot is attached.

Device model: Galaxy Tab S10 plus

Hi,

Looks like you need to disable "Show tab bar" in order to be able to set address bar to be displayed at the bottom. Does this work for you?

What are other features missing/frozen?

Yes yes finally. It worked! Truly grateful to you.

There is a feature not working unless the address bar is placed to the bottom, which is scrolling right and left between tabs by passing just one finger on the address bar.
